---Now, though Vault will be quite a spectacle itself, I have another signing that I'm extremely excited for. It's kind of a homecoming for me, and it's a dream come true to be able to bring my recent success back to the place that first put me on its path.

On Nov. 30th, I'll be appearing at my alma mater, Delta College in Bay City, MI, to sign copies of Dead Duck from 11 am-1 pm. And here's why that is so important…

For those who don't know, I attended Delta College from 1994-2001. In my second year, my English professor, Joan Ramm, caught me drawing cartoons in the back of her class one day. Rather than scold me, Joan took note of my art and brought me aboard Delta's school paper, The Delta Collegiate, where she was faculty advisor. I wound up working on the Collegiate for my remaining years at Delta ('95-'01), where I was the resident cartoonist, arts and entertainment editor, and co-editor in chief in my final year. During this time, I made the best friends of my entire life, people whom I'm still close to today. I won awards, had incredible life experiences, and became the person I am today, all because of Delta College, the Delta Collegiate and Joan Ramm. So it's with great pride and appreciation that I'll be talking to Joan Ramm's Mass Media class (one of the three classes I took with Joan) prior to my book signing. Delta was the best home away from home I'd ever experienced, and I cannot wait to return.

In don't know where I'll be located on Delta's campus just yet, but I'll make it known very soon. In the meantime, anyone in the area, particularly any of my old Collegiate crew who can make it, are encouraged to come to my signing. As a point of interest, you'll find several old Collegiate members making appearances in the pages of Dead Duck, further proof of Delta's wonderful and continual influence.
